The vivo X60 Pro has a general score of 78.8, which is a little bit better than HTC 10's global score of 75.7. Even though vivo X60 Pro is a little bit heavier than HTC 10, it's somewhat thinner and also notably newer. HTC 10 has a little more vivid screen than vivo X60 Pro, because although it has a really smaller display, it also counts with a better 1440 x 2560px resolution and a higher number of pixels per inch of display.
Vivo X60 Pro has a slightly bigger memory capacity for applications, games, photos and videos than HTC 10, because although it has no slot for an external memory card, it also counts with more internal storage capacity. The vivo X60 Pro has a superior CPU than HTC 10, because it has a greater number of cores (and faster) and 8 GB more RAM memory.
Vivo X60 Pro counts with a superior battery life than HTC 10, because it has 4200mAh of battery capacity instead of 3000mAh. Vivo X60 Pro shoots much clearer photographs and videos than HTC 10, because although it has lower video frame rate, and they both have the same aperture and the same video quality, the vivo X60 Pro also counts with a larger sensor shooting better quality photographs and a way better resolution back-facing camera.
